Camp Kesem is a national organization driven by college student leaders and dedicated to supporting children through and beyond a parent’s cancer. Our main event is our week-long summer camp that occurs the first week of July. This is where campers and selected counselors come together for a week of fun games and activities. It is also time for campers to be surrounded by other kids who understand the struggles they are facing and counselors that are there to support them in any way they can. The best part is that camp is
100% free to all campers.
Though one part of Kesem is our summer camp opportunity, there are many other volunteer and leadership opportunities available through our chapter. This is what we call our “through and beyond” support. We have our Friends and Family Days, where campers and counselors get to catch up throughout the year and many fundraising opportunities that go towards our camp week.
